Overview
Part: BZT52 series Type: Zener Diode
Key Specs:
- Total power dissipation: ≤ 590 mW
- Working voltage range: nominal 2.4 V to 75 V
- Forward voltage: max 0.9 V at IF = 10 mA
- Tolerance series: ±2 % and approximately ±5 %
Features:
- Total power dissipation: ≤ 590 mW
- Two tolerance series: ±2 % and approximately ±5 %
- Wide working voltage range: nominal 2.4 V to 75 V (E24 range)
- Small plastic package suitable for surface-mounted design
- Low differential resistance
Applications:
- General regulation functions
Package:
- SOD123

Thermal Information
Table 6. Thermal characteristics
| Symbol | Parameter Conditions | Min | Typ | Max | Unit | ||
|---|---|---|---|---|---|---|---|
| Rth(j-a) | thermal resistance from in free air | [1] - | - | 350 | K/W | ||
| junction to ambient | [2] - | - | 210 | K/W | |||
| Rth(j-sp) | thermal resistance from junction to solder point | [3] - | - | 55 | K/W |
